Episode 11: Autism A Dad's Journey - Luis Bayardo
It's so rare to have a father join us on the podcast, but today we have a special guest, Luis Bayardo. He is the author of Autism: A Dad's Journey and the father of two sons who have autism. Join us on this episode as he pulls back the curtain on the life of raising children on the spectrum.

Episode 9: Autism and sleep
According to the research, 40% – 80% of children with autism have problems with sleep. <br /><br />In this episode we cover the benefits, the recommended sleep guidelines from the National Sleep Foundation, theories centered around sleep, the importance of lighting and its role in sleep.
